The E-Series 3-Axis is an industrial CNC fixed bridge router equipped to handle heavy-duty applications that require rapid, deep, and heavy cuts in plastics, composites, fiberglass, dense woods, and nonferrous metals. Its highly responsive drive motors offer high feed rates, high material removal rates, and quick acceleration/deceleration to produce deep cuts faster and with better finishes than traditional slow, deep cutting operations.

BENEFITS OF A TWIN TABLE DESIGN

A unique benefit of the twin table design is that when one table is in the forward position and one is completely back, you can place a part on each table that is the same size as the table and still independently machine completely around both parts. You can also perform pendulum processing or add a second spindle for dual process capability.

SAFE, EFFICIENT PRODUCTION WITH PENDULUM PROCESSING

With the twin table configuration, you can load Table 1 safely while performing machining operations on Table 2. Then, while the machine switches to processing material on the newly loaded Table 1, you safely remove parts from Table 2 and reload the table. This technique is known as Pendulum Processing, and it keeps your production continuously flowing.

FLEXIBILITY WITH TWIN SPINDLES AND DUAL PROCESS TECHNOLOGY

By adding a second spindle to the twin table configuration, you gain flexibility in your production, a value equal to buying an additional machine without the expense or taking up valuable floor space. You can cut twice as many parts in the same time period. 

  • Use one spindle to machine one process on Table 1, while the other spindle machines an entirely different process on Table 2.
  • Use both spindles on an alternating basis to perform different operations on a single workpiece. 
  • Use both spindles on a fixed center distance to produce identical parts at the same time on the same table (while still pendulum processing) or different tables.
  • Use both spindles on a frequently adjusting or varying center distance while working on a single process.
  • Park one spindle and electronically lock the tables together, giving full table access to the other spindle for machining large or oversized parts.
HIGH THROUGHPUT AND VERSATILITY WITH MULTIPLE SPINDLES

Adding additional spindles to your machine gives you the versatility equivalent to having multiple machines. All spindles can be cutting identical parts simultaneously to keep production flowing, or consider, for example, equipping one or two spindles with 4th axis capability aggregates (specialized tooling) and when the initial 3-axis processes are finished, park those spindles, and send in the 4-axis spindle(s) to machine the sides of the material without losing the time required for refixturing. The E-Series supports up to 8 spindles.

C-AXIS

With a C-Axis (aka 4th axis), you can machine at an angle, including on the sides of your material, to create complex contours (such as helixes), otherwise not possible with a 3-axis machine. This comes standard on a 5-axis machine.

Air Blast (240x300)

AIR BLAST

Bursts of air keep tools cool and remove debris and chips from the cut without the need for coolant.

Mql (240x300)

MQL

Primarily used for metals, Minimum Quantity Lubrication (MQL) dispenses only the amount of lubricant needed for your specific operation to keep tools cool and improve cut quality.

DIRECTIONAL AIR BLAST

Directional air blast blows air on the tooltip to aid in removing debris and cool tools. The direction of air changes relative to the path of the machine. It can be turned on/off via M-Code.

Auto Tool Measurement Single Options Hero

ATLM SYSTEM (METROL)

Precisely measures the length of your tool and automatically feeds that value into your CNC machine controls.

Close-up of the TS27R tool measurement option used in CNC machines for high-precision calibration.

ATLM SYSTEM: TS27R (RENISHAW)

Precisely measures the length and diameter of your tool and automatically feeds that value into your CNC machine controls. It also detects if a tool is broken.

(None)_NC4_Blue (240x300)

ATLM: NC4 (RENISHAW)

Precisely measures the length and diameter of your tool, without contact, and automatically feeds that value into your CNC machine controls. It also detects if a tool is broken. NC4 is application dependent; table constraints may apply.

Automatic lubrication system in CNC machine by Lincoln, ensuring smooth operation and durability.

AUTOMATIC GREASE LUBRICATION

Automatically greases your tools, bearings, and ball screws at regular intervals.

Servo Positioning Dust Hood (240x300)

SERVO HOOD™

With CR Onsrud’s innovative servo-positioned dust hood, we have improved upon the standard 2-position dust hood and given the CNC machine the ability to automatically adjust the dust hood’s height offset based on tool length, relative to the workpiece. This helps customers, who machine with a variety of tool lengths, get the most effective dust collection regardless of the tool length.

AGGREGATE RING

The Aggregate Anti-Rotational Retention Ring mounts to the underside of the spindle, giving it the capability to pick up specialized tooling from the Automatic Tool Changer and preventing the aggregate head from rotating during machining.

Mono Function Line CNC Aggregate for focused, single-task machining operations

90° HEAD

A 90° head gives you the capability to perform lateral machining operations on a 3-axis machine.

Close-up of a Duo Agg 90-degree aggregate head, ideal for CNC machining complex angles with precision.

DUO 90° HEAD

A Duo 90° head gives you the capability to perform lateral machining operations using different tools in opposite directions on a 3-axis machine.

Quattro Aggregate tool for CNC machining by C.R. Onsrud, featuring multiple collet holders for high-efficiency multi-axis routing applications.

QUAD 90° HEAD

With a Quad 90° head, you’ll easily add lateral machining operations to your 3-axis machine using four tools in each direction.

Vario Viso Aggregate demonstrating multi-axis drill flexibility for accurate operations

ADJUSTABLE ANGLE

An adjustable angle head allows you to set the angle at which you want to cut, for up to 5-sided machining on a 3-axis machine.

Ultra Line Vario Viso Aggregate with digital angle indicator for precise multi-angle machining operations.

FLEX ANGLE

With a flex angle head, you can perform horizontal and angular machining operations on a 3-axis machine without having to reposition your workpiece.

SURFACE PROBE

A surface probe or part finder helps your machine accurately identify the position of your material on your worktable.

PROBING
(RENISHAW PROBE)

A part-probing system adjusts the origin of your part prior to machining, performs in-process QC for tight tolerance applications, and performs post-machining QC to approve or reject a part before it is taken out of its work holding.

placeholder.png

LASER PATTERN PROJECTION SYSTEM

Without touching the material, a Laser Pattern Projection Alignment System provides true to scale patterns of one or several aligned or nested objects, transferred from CAD software onto the CNC table.

Note: This option is common for high-mix shops and when using vacuum pods.

Fiducial Vision System Single Option Hero

VISION RECOGNITION (FIDUCIAL)

A fiducial vision recognition system scans for reference points to identify a sheet’s position. The program and tool paths automatically adjust to the position.

Note: This option is common in the signmaking industry where sheets are otherwise difficult to align perfectly.
